| /*
 | |
|  *  ======== CC1310_LAUNCHXL_fxns.c ========
 | |
|  *  This file contains the board-specific initialization functions.
 | |
|  */
 | |
| 
 | |
| #include <stdbool.h>
 | |
| #include <stddef.h>
 | |
| #include <stdint.h>
 | |
| 
 | |
| #include <ti/devices/cc13x0/driverlib/ioc.h>
 | |
| #include <ti/devices/cc13x0/driverlib/cpu.h>
 | |
| 
 | |
| #include <ti/drivers/pin/PINCC26XX.h>
 | |
| 
 | |
| #include <ti/drivers/Board.h>
 | |
| 
 | |
| 
 | |
| /*
 | |
|  *  ======== CC1310_LAUNCHXL_sendExtFlashByte ========
 | |
|  */
 | |
| void CC1310_LAUNCHXL_sendExtFlashByte(PIN_Handle pinHandle, uint8_t byte)
 | |
| {
 | |
|     uint8_t i;
 | |
| 
 | |
|     /* SPI Flash CS */
 | |
|     PIN_setOutputValue(pinHandle, IOID_20, 0);
 | |
| 
 | |
|     for (i = 0; i < 8; i++) {
 | |
|         PIN_setOutputValue(pinHandle, IOID_10, 0);  /* SPI Flash CLK */
 | |
| 
 | |
|         /* SPI Flash MOSI */
 | |
|         PIN_setOutputValue(pinHandle, IOID_9, (byte >> (7 - i)) & 0x01);
 | |
|         PIN_setOutputValue(pinHandle, IOID_10, 1);  /* SPI Flash CLK */
 | |
| 
 | |
|         /*
 | |
|          * Waste a few cycles to keep the CLK high for at
 | |
|          * least 45% of the period.
 | |
|          * 3 cycles per loop: 8 loops @ 48 Mhz = 0.5 us.
 | |
|          */
 | |
|         CPUdelay(8);
 | |
|     }
 | |
| 
 | |
|     PIN_setOutputValue(pinHandle, IOID_10, 0);  /* CLK */
 | |
|     PIN_setOutputValue(pinHandle, IOID_20, 1);  /* CS */
 | |
| 
 | |
|     /*
 | |
|      * Keep CS high at least 40 us
 | |
|      * 3 cycles per loop: 700 loops @ 48 Mhz ~= 44 us
 | |
|      */
 | |
|     CPUdelay(700);
 | |
| }
 | |
| 
 | |
| /*
 | |
|  *  ======== CC1310_LAUNCHXL_wakeUpExtFlash ========
 | |
|  */
 | |
| void CC1310_LAUNCHXL_wakeUpExtFlash(void)
 | |
| {
 | |
|     PIN_Config extFlashPinTable[] = {
 | |
|         /* SPI Flash CS */
 | |
|         IOID_20 | PIN_GPIO_OUTPUT_EN | PIN_GPIO_HIGH | PIN_PUSHPULL |
 | |
|                 PIN_INPUT_DIS | PIN_DRVSTR_MED,
 | |
|         PIN_TERMINATE
 | |
|     };
 | |
|     PIN_State extFlashPinState;
 | |
|     PIN_Handle extFlashPinHandle = PIN_open(&extFlashPinState, extFlashPinTable);
 | |
| 
 | |
|     /*
 | |
|      *  To wake up we need to toggle the chip select at
 | |
|      *  least 20 ns and ten wait at least 35 us.
 | |
|      */
 | |
| 
 | |
|     /* Toggle chip select for ~20ns to wake ext. flash */
 | |
|     PIN_setOutputValue(extFlashPinHandle, IOID_20, 0);
 | |
|     /* 3 cycles per loop: 1 loop @ 48 Mhz ~= 62 ns */
 | |
|     CPUdelay(1);
 | |
|     PIN_setOutputValue(extFlashPinHandle, IOID_20, 1);
 | |
|     /* 3 cycles per loop: 560 loops @ 48 Mhz ~= 35 us */
 | |
|     CPUdelay(560);
 | |
| 
 | |
|     PIN_close(extFlashPinHandle);
 | |
| }
 | |
| 
 | |
| /*
 | |
|  *  ======== CC1310_LAUNCHXL_shutDownExtFlash ========
 | |
|  */
 | |
| void CC1310_LAUNCHXL_shutDownExtFlash(void)
 | |
| {
 | |
|     /*
 | |
|      *  To be sure we are putting the flash into sleep and not waking it,
 | |
|      *  we first have to make a wake up call
 | |
|      */
 | |
|     CC1310_LAUNCHXL_wakeUpExtFlash();
 | |
| 
 | |
|     PIN_Config extFlashPinTable[] = {
 | |
|         /* SPI Flash CS*/
 | |
|         IOID_20 | PIN_GPIO_OUTPUT_EN | PIN_GPIO_HIGH | PIN_PUSHPULL |
 | |
|                 PIN_INPUT_DIS | PIN_DRVSTR_MED,
 | |
|         /* SPI Flash CLK */
 | |
|         IOID_10 | PIN_GPIO_OUTPUT_EN | PIN_GPIO_LOW | PIN_PUSHPULL |
 | |
|                 PIN_INPUT_DIS | PIN_DRVSTR_MED,
 | |
|         /* SPI Flash MOSI */
 | |
|         IOID_9 | PIN_GPIO_OUTPUT_EN | PIN_GPIO_LOW | PIN_PUSHPULL |
 | |
|                 PIN_INPUT_DIS | PIN_DRVSTR_MED,
 | |
|         /* SPI Flash MISO */
 | |
|         IOID_8 | PIN_INPUT_EN | PIN_PULLDOWN,
 | |
|         PIN_TERMINATE
 | |
|     };
 | |
|     PIN_State extFlashPinState;
 | |
|     PIN_Handle extFlashPinHandle = PIN_open(&extFlashPinState, extFlashPinTable);
 | |
| 
 | |
|     uint8_t extFlashShutdown = 0xB9;
 | |
| 
 | |
|     CC1310_LAUNCHXL_sendExtFlashByte(extFlashPinHandle, extFlashShutdown);
 | |
| 
 | |
|     PIN_close(extFlashPinHandle);
 | |
| }
 | |
| 
 | |
| /*
 | |
|  *  ======== Board_initHook ========
 | |
|  *  Called by Board_init() to perform board-specific initialization.
 | |
|  */
 | |
| void Board_initHook()
 | |
| {
 | |
|     CC1310_LAUNCHXL_shutDownExtFlash();
 | |
| }
